Curry night organised by Northampton trade unions to support Jeremy Corbyn's leadership bid
The event is being organised by branches of ASLEF and the Communication Workers' Union, who are affiliates of the party.
The event will take place on Sunday 17th July at The Royal Bengal Indian Restaurant, 41 Bridge Street, Northampton, NN1 1NS from 19:00. There will be a choice of cuisine from a set menu, including vegetarian options, some entertainment, a raffle and more.

Hide AdTickets cost £15 and 50% will go toward the Jeremy Corbyn for Leader Campaign Fund.
Paul Bosworth, Deputy Branch Secretary of the South Midlands Postal Branch of the CWU said: "It is looking increasingly likely that a leadership challenge will take place against Jeremy Corbyn, as such it is only right that the significant numbers of local party members that stand by Jeremy and his huge democratic mandate, get together in this way, enjoy themselves and fund raise at the same time."
Graham Croucher, branch secretary of the ASLEF Bletchley Branch, said: "The night is open to all Labour Party members, supporters, trade unionists and like minded individuals. We hope for a really good evening and that we can show that Northampton stands with Jeremy!"
